Learning Computer Graphics Utilizing Blocks on Web Environment

Computer graphics has been applied for generating digital contents in many fields such as virtual/augmented reality, as well as traditional applications such as visual effects. However, serious mathematical background obstructs people from learning computer graphics. The proposed paper focuses on computer graphics for generating an effective e-learning platform. We utilized a block-based system, which is implemented by WebGL and delivers educational interests and enhanced accessibility. Also, users could practice the theory of graphics using processing language and check their programming result directly.

Comparison and Performance Analysis of App and Web-based One-stop Attendance Management

This paper presents the structure of an electronic attendance system composed of OAA (One-stop Attendance and Absence)-server and client. We compare simultaneous check, fraudulent attendance, prevention of leaving the classroom, and extra equipment according to check methods, and also present a method of app and web-based attendance management. NFC and BLE-based app and location-based web for attendance management were applied to classrooms. Issues with electronic attendance management and resolution methods were also presented. RESTful web service was defined for attendance management and performance analysis was conducted according to thread numbers of OAA-server and parser types of XML and JSON.

This study aims to investigate the effect of promotion benefit level on consumers’ patronage intention in limited-quantity promotion (LQP) by considering the mediating influence of perceived availability. A mathematical model is built and an experiment is conducted to demonstrate that the effect of promotion benefit level on patronage intention is reversed U-shaped in LQP. When promotion benefit level is low, patronage intention increases as promotion benefit level increases, whereas when promotion benefit level is high, patronage intention would decrease as promotion benefit level increases. The mediating influence of perceived availability between promotion benefit level and patronage intention explains this phenomenon. Empirical results show that perceived availability is negatively related with promotion benefit level and patronage intention is positively related with perceived availability. Those results can be used by retailers to determine the most appropriate benefit level in LQP.

Recent years, as China is experiencing a rapid development, the educational investments are undergoing a sharp increase compared to past decades. Educational investment has become a crucial aspect that deeply influencing the future development of a country. What's more importantly, knowing the future investments of education is a crucial affair that decides the future tendency of related projects such as government management, cooperation investment and personnel training. Decision makers cannot make any effective decisions without knowing the future investments of education under all these circumstances. However, it is fairly difficult for people to obtain the predicted data of educational investments without the aid of mathematical and computational modeling. Therefore, in this article, we aim at presenting a series of solutions for the prediction of educational investment for China based on multiple linear regression (MLR), artificial neural networks (ANNs) and grey model GM (1,1). Multiple comparisons are made for deciding whether model should be used under different external conditions. Our research successfully shows that all these models are available for practical applications and scientists and other related people can choose their suitable models alternatively for the sake of making a better prediction under different circumstances.

The purpose of this research is to verify the effectiveness of the influence of an afterschool reading program on changing multicultural perception. The afterschool reading program at the elementary school is composed of 12sessions. The main content was reading a foreign fairy tale and then having a discussion on about it. The total number of subjects was 44 people, 21 in the experiment group and 23 people in the control group. Each group did a preliminary inspection before participating in the program, a post inspection after participating, and a later inspection 5 weeks after finishing the program. Research results showed that the reading-studying program improves the cognitive level of elementary school students’ multicultural perception. Moreover, the analysis results of multicultural awareness levels concerning the cognitive factors and defined factors seemed to be more effective than behavioral factors.

Auto-reconstruction of Shredded Document based on Matching Models

Shredding auto-reconstruction is a hot research topic in pattern recognition. The research progress can produce certain effect to various fields. The purpose of this paper is to study shredding auto-reconstruction based on regular shredded document from shredders, to obtain a practical and efficient splicing algorithm to auto- reconstruction of strip shaped shredded text documents and block shapedshredded text documents. For strips, this paper uses the pretreatment, the similarity matching model, combined with the optimalHamilton path algorithm, for which we get a good result with 100% correct rate and no human intervention. For blocks, first, this paper pretreats the fragments. And then uses the row cluster model to divide all debris to some rows, and then uses the similarity model with direct reverse matching model to achieve the shredding auto-restore in different rows. At last, we use line spacing matching model to get the result that has a high correct rate reaching to 90% with little human intervention. In this paper, the design of some algorithms is original. Combined with the present feasible algorithm, we get an ideal result.
